SINTESIS DAN UJI AKTIVITAS ANTIBAKTERI DARI SENYAWA 1-FENIL-3-(1-NAFTIL)-5-(2-KLOROFENIL)-2-PIRAZOLIN

Dahliarti ', Hilwan Yuda Teruna, Jasril '

Abstract


Pyrazoline is a bioactive compound but it is rare in nature. Pyrazoline has bioactivities
which are anti-inflammantory, antimicrobial, antibacterial, antidiabetic and antipyretic
activity. In this study this compound has been synthesized by reacting phenylhydrazine
with (E)-3-(2-chlorophenyl)-1-(naphtalen-1-yl)prop-2-en-1-one chalcone and then
catalyzed by acetic acid using microwave irradiation method. The yield of 1-phenyl-3-
(1-naphtyl)-5-(2-chlorophenyl)-2-pyrazoline compound was 76,23%. This pyrazoline
was characterized using UV-Vis, IR, 1 H-NMR and 13 C-NMR spectrometer. Bioactivity
test showed that the pyrazoline compound does not have antibacterial activity againt
Gram-positive and Gram-negative bacteria.
